7 Best Short Stories by Mark Twain brings together a selection of tales that showcase the wit, humor, and social commentary of one of America’s greatest authors. These stories delve into human nature, cultural observations, and satirical humor, reflecting Twain’s unique voice and storytelling prowess. The collection includes: About Barbers – A humorous account of the timeless experience of visiting a barber and the quirks that come with it. A Dog’s Tale – A touching story from the perspective of a dog, highlighting themes of loyalty, innocence, and the bond between humans and animals. A Ghost Story – A comedic take on ghostly encounters, filled with Twain’s characteristic irony. A Monument to Adam – A satirical piece examining the nature of humanity, using biblical references with Twain’s humorous twist. Eve’s Diary – A humorous retelling of the Garden of Eden from Eve’s point of view, accompanied by charming illustrations. Extracts from Adam’s Diary – A companion to Eve’s Diary, this story humorously reflects on the creation from Adam’s perspective. The Stolen White Elephant – A short detective mystery wrapped in absurdity, where an investigation spirals into chaos. Bonus: Mark Twain; The Licensed Jester by George Orwell – A critical and thoughtful exploration of Twain’s work and influence.
